I "lightly bumped" the front of my Rincon a short while back and was upset with the damage that was done for this minor tap. If you bump a Rincon just right on the front fenders by the upper outer corners of the headlights it breaks the headlight assembly. The fenders are soft and "give" but the light does not, therefore the headlight gets all of the pressure. I think it cost me around $65-$70 for the new light.

To help with this problem I ran a piece of 1"x 1/8th aluminum from the outermost mounting point of the headlight to the bolt that goes upwards through the front rack. All of this is up-under the wheel housings.
Each end gets drilled and bent a little to get it to fit. Very difficult to explain in words on here but it is very simple to do and adds alot of strenght to the outer corners of the headlight. It looks nice also and is well hidden. Just look in this area on your Rincon and you will see what I am refering to.
